index
:
cliapp
master
Python framework for command line utilities
Lars Wirzenius <liw@liw.fi>
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
cliapp
/
settings.py
Age
Commit message (
Expand
)
Author
Files
Lines
2017-08-27
Fix: disable unicode_literals from the future
Lars Wirzenius
1
-1
/
+1
2017-08-19
Add: Python3 support
Lars Wirzenius
1
-10
/
+19
2017-08-08
Drop: meliae support
Lars Wirzenius
1
-2
/
+2
2017-03-24
Fix to handle empty "config:" in a YAML config file
Lars Wirzenius
1
-1
/
+1
2016-02-20
Fix for E731 "do not assign a lambda expression, use a def"
Michel Alexandre Salim
1
-1
/
+2
2016-02-19
Unhide hidden options
Lars Wirzenius
1
-4
/
+4
2016-01-08
Added --log=stderr to log to STDERR
Roland Mas
1
-0
/
+1
2015-12-27
Add XDG Base Directory specification support
Lars Wirzenius
1
-0
/
+21
2015-12-26
Give better error message if YAML config is bad
Lars Wirzenius
1
-0
/
+21
2015-12-23
Add support for YAML config files
Lars Wirzenius
1
-20
/
+56
2015-12-05
Sort --no-foo after --foo
Lars Wirzenius
1
-22
/
+41
2015-11-08
Require config files specified by --config to exist
Lars Wirzenius
1
-2
/
+6
2015-08-29
Fix whitespace, line length
Lars Wirzenius
1
-0
/
+1
2015-08-29
Allow comma in StringListSetting values
Jan Gerber
1
-8
/
+19
2015-05-01
Whitespace fixes for PEP8
Lars Wirzenius
1
-8
/
+8
2015-04-18
Add running of pylint in 'make check' and fix things
Lars Wirzenius
1
-32
/
+34
2015-04-18
Run pep8 in "make check" and fix so it passes
Lars Wirzenius
1
-70
/
+73
2013-12-06
Make Settings.require accept many arguments
Lars Wirzenius
1
-6
/
+10
2013-11-15
Update copyright year
Lars Wirzenius
1
-1
/
+1
2013-10-30
Nicely report unknown variables in config files
Lars Wirzenius
1
-6
/
+18
2013-06-09
Remove trailing whitespace from ends of lines
Lars Wirzenius
1
-77
/
+77
2013-04-30
Expand the Settings.as_cp method description
Lars Wirzenius
1
-1
/
+7
2013-02-10
Add --help-all option to show hidden options too
Lars Wirzenius
1
-0
/
+17
2013-02-10
Show/hide hidden options as requested
Lars Wirzenius
1
-12
/
+20
2013-02-10
Actually suppress help for hidden options
Lars Wirzenius
1
-2
/
+6
2013-02-10
Add a hidden attribute to settingses
Lars Wirzenius
1
-6
/
+12
2013-01-19
Use new formatter for --help output to list subcommand summaries
Lars Wirzenius
1
-16
/
+4
2013-01-19
Add performance group for settings
Lars Wirzenius
1
-2
/
+6
2013-01-19
Add config_group_name
Lars Wirzenius
1
-26
/
+33
2013-01-19
Add option group for config files and settings options
Lars Wirzenius
1
-11
/
+18
2013-01-19
Add a "Logging" group for logging options
Lars Wirzenius
1
-5
/
+9
2012-12-19
Add a way to compute setting values
Lars Wirzenius
1
-1
/
+3
2012-12-19
Re-implement automatically added options
Lars Wirzenius
1
-5
/
+39
2012-12-11
Add --no-foo for every boolean --foo
Lars Wirzenius
1
-0
/
+20
2012-12-03
Add memory-profiling-interval setting
Lars Wirzenius
1
-0
/
+4
2012-06-30
Add group=grouptitle arguments to all settings
Lars Wirzenius
1
-4
/
+5
2012-04-14
Fix syntax error and missing import for gc
Lars Wirzenius
1
-1
/
+1
2012-04-08
Improve logging documentation a bit
Lars Wirzenius
1
-1
/
+2
2012-02-23
Merge changes from elsewhere
Lars Wirzenius
1
-12
/
+40
2012-02-22
Make log files have 0600 file mode by default
Lars Wirzenius
1
-0
/
+4
2012-02-22
Add a plugin system
Lars Wirzenius
1
-1
/
+1
2012-02-22
Add settings groups
Lars Wirzenius
1
-12
/
+31
2012-02-22
Make Settings act a bit more like a dict.
Lars Wirzenius
1
-0
/
+9
2012-02-11
Add way to set settings to values parsed from raw strings
Lars Wirzenius
1
-2
/
+8
2012-02-11
Make as_cp retain all sections from config files
Lars Wirzenius
1
-0
/
+12
2012-02-11
Refactor dump_config to use as_cp
Lars Wirzenius
1
-4
/
+1
2012-02-11
Add as_cp method to return settings values as a ConfigParser
Lars Wirzenius
1
-1
/
+9
2012-01-11
fix setting booleans to false in config files
Lars Wirzenius
1
-1
/
+7
2011-12-03
update --log help text
Lars Wirzenius
1
-1
/
+1
2011-09-27
Change license to be GPL version 2 or later.
Lars Wirzenius
1
-5
/
+6
[next]